Neutron halos and their relations to the structure of El resonances ar
e examined in a microscopic random phase approximation continuum calcu
lation of (208)pb. Our results predict the occurrence of small but dis
tinct El peaks located in the low energy tail of the giant dipole reso
nance and consisting of highly coherent neutron particle-hole excitati
ons whose energy and strength are found to correspond well to photoneu
tron and electron scattering data. This work suggests that the high cu
rrent interest in the appearance of neutron halos in light exotic nucl
ei could constructively be channeled to investigate similar occurrence
s in heavier systems where model calculations have already been thorou
ghly tested.
